Noida’s Big Projects: From Jewar Airport To Film City, Mega Plans Set To Transform The City’s Future

Noida is undergoing significant transformation with several mega projects, including the Noida International Airport, International Film City, and metro expansion, aimed at boosting its economy and connectivity. These projects are expected to create jobs, improve infrastructure, and establish Noida as a major hub for industry, technology, and real estate.

Noida, a planned industrial township established in 1976, has evolved into a major economic hub in Uttar Pradesh. The city is undergoing significant transformation with several mega projects. The Noida International Airport in Jewar is expected to reduce congestion at Delhi's Indira Gandhi International Airport and improve regional connectivity. The International Film City in Sector 21 will create around 50,000 jobs and benefit up to seven lakh people indirectly. The Aqua Line Metro expansion will improve connectivity within Noida and Greater Noida, while the proposed Delhi-Varanasi high-speed rail project will strengthen connectivity across major cities in Uttar Pradesh. Global companies like Microsoft and Google are investing in data centres and digital infrastructure, further boosting Noida's growth as a technology and data services hub.
